Output 3de31c54a30590723c644c9d4b6341791172df3542fa7eeabb6fae50145fdc94:0

value
139018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f9dba1d05baa98284511306a94e62b35155a314 OP_EQUALVERIFY OP_CHECKSIG
address
1E6NaVnEu2rDG66XWwvs196Jd6Mr1ME2iV
transaction
3de31c54a30590723c644c9d4b6341791172df3542fa7eeabb6fae50145fdc94
confirmations
412523
spent
true